**DUTIES**:
After Hours Workers are responsible for providing crisis intervention, assessment, child protection and after-hours
emergency services.
- Assessing requests for service with reference to risk, functioning and service needs.
- Providing immediate crisis intervention and conducting child protection investigations.
- Apprehending children at risk and placing in appropriate and or available settings.
- Supervising and physically caring for children awaiting placement.
- Referring and providing information to professional and community resources.
- Completing all required written documentation.
